EPSS (Exploit Prediction Scoring System) is a daily probability model maintained by FIRST.org. It estimates the likelihood a CVE will be exploited in production environments within the next 30 days, derived from real-world threat intelligence signals.

Description

Summary

The OAuth2 token refresh endpoint (POST /api/v1/oauth2-credential/refresh/:credentialId) is in WHITELIST_URLS, meaning it requires no authentication. It decrypts the stored credential (containing clientId, clientSecret, refresh_token), sends a refresh request to the configured OAuth provider, and returns the new access_token directly in the response body.

Root Cause

// packages/server/src/routes/oauth2/index.ts:393-402
res.json({
    success: true,
    message: 'OAuth2 token refreshed successfully',
    credentialId: credential.id,
    tokenInfo: {
        ...tokenData,  // ← includes access_token!
        has_new_refresh_token: !!tokenData.refresh_token,
        expires_at: updatedCredentialData.expires_at
    }
})

Whitelist entry at packages/server/src/utils/constants.ts:40.

Attack Chain

  1. Attacker obtains a credential ID (via Finding 2 / public chatflow leak, or enumeration)
  2. Attacker calls POST /api/v1/oauth2-credential/refresh/:credentialId (no auth required)
  3. Server decrypts credential, sends refresh request to OAuth provider with user's client_secret
  4. Server returns the new access_token in the response to the attacker
  5. Attacker uses the token to access the victim's connected service (Google, Microsoft, etc.)

Docker Validation

POST /api/v1/oauth2-credential/refresh/fake-uuid returns {"message":"Credential not found"} (not 401 Unauthorized), proving the endpoint processes the request without authentication.

Impact

  • OAuth2 access token theft for any connected service
  • Full access to the victim's third-party accounts (Google, Microsoft, GitHub, etc.)
  • Client secret transmitted to OAuth provider during refresh
  • Can also be used for DoS by exhausting refresh token quota

Suggested Fix

Remove the refresh endpoint from WHITELIST_URLS and require authentication:

// Remove from WHITELIST_URLS in constants.ts
// Add authentication check in the route handler
